Fifty years of poems from the Community of Writers poetry workshopThe Community of Writers (formerly Community of Writers at Squaw Valley) celebrates fifty years of its annual summer poetry workshop in Olympic Valley, California, with this collection of one hundred and forty poems first composed there. Edited by writers workshop codirector Lisa Alvarez and introduced by longtime poetry director Robert Hass, the book is divided into three sections: poems that evoke the Valleys physical setting, with its graniteandpine mountain beauty; poems that peer into the poetic process, filled with inspiration and idiosyncrasy; and poems of all shapes and kinds that owe their origins to the workshop and its productive morning review sessions. Contributors include both workshop staff and participants, among them Lucille Clifton, Sharon Olds, Al Young, Matthew Zapruder, Harryette Mullen, Galway Kinnell, Rita Dove, Cornelius Eady, Robert Hass, and Forrest Gander.The title of the collection comes from a question posed by original poetry director Galway Kinnell: Then why to these rocks / Do I keep coming back why. It speaks to the special community nurtured in this stunning setting, one that has inspired poets worldwidemany of whom developed significant bodies of awardwinning work in its creative and generative atmosphere.
